A large botanical garden has a total of 500 trees, shrubs, and cacti. According to this circle graph, how many trees are in the

garden? 38 62 100 190 Circle graph with three sections. Trees 38 percent, Cacti 25 percent, Shrubs 37 percent

Answer: \text{The number of trees in the garden}=190

Step-by-step explanation:

Given: The total number of trees, shrubs and cacti in the botanical garden = 500

The percentage of trees in the circle graph = 38%

Therefore, the number of trees in the garden is given by :-

\text{The number of trees}=38\%\ of\ \text{Total plants}\\\\\Rightarrow\text{The number of trees}=0.38\times500}\\\\\Rightarrow\text{The number of trees}=190

\text{Hence, the number of trees in the garden}=190
